Notes from the Fortune-telling Parrot: Islam and the Struggle for Religious Pluralism in Pakistan - Comparative Islamic Studies
David Pinault
Explores the richness of Pakistan's religious landscape, giving attention to a number of topics: Shia flagellation processions, Urdu-language pulp fiction, streetside rituals involving animals (pariah-kites and fortune-telling parrots), and the use of sorcery to contend with the jinns that are believed to infest cities such as Lahore.
